The tree pose
Take a yoga mat. Stand straight. Now slowly raise one foot and put it on your other knee. Try to keep your body in balance while balancing your position, slowly raise your arms above your head and inhale. Now connect both palms and form a surya namskar posture with one leg. Not only do you have to balance your entire body weight on one leg, but you also try to focus your mind and find silence in your head.

The Camel Pose
Kneel down on the yoga mat Now exhale and lean backwards, stretching your arms back and touching your toes. You will feel your spine expand with your abdominal muscles. Stretch your neck and move your head backwards. Stay like that for a minute, then release it to get back in the starting position and sit on your heels. This posture generates energy and can help to relieve mental and physical tension.

Lateral angle position
The rotated side angle position is also known as parivrtta parsvakonasana. Start with Tadasna, slowly spread your legs apart, then spread your arms wide apart. Turn your upper body to the right, gently bend your right knee, bring your left palm to the left, and place it on the right side of your right foot. Stay in the same position for about 30 seconds, then return to the Tadasana. Repeat the same thing, just turn the body over to the other side. Along with the physical challenge, this attitude allows your brain to stay in the present.

The handstand
No easy pose, basically defying gravity with it pose. If you are a beginner, you can take the support of a wall. In addition to a good circulation in the head, it can reduce anxiety and stress in just a few minutes.
